It still works fine in gecko browsers and it still fails in IE. Same IE error: File: actionitems.xls, Unknown File Type, 87.0 KB, and the File does not exist. The filename is correct.
Can you check exactly what headers are getting sent? (Live HTTP headers in mozilla/firefox, or tcpdump/ethereal)
I've had problems in the past with Tomcat where I set the content type, forwarded to another page, and tomcat somehow forgot the content type. I ended up having to set it twice.
So, if you can check your headers, you might just spot something wrong with them that you can fix with a big stick
